Transaction 217625f94132e6389459b70a7e26f183402f6cadfbc3159c1a98e22a758033d5
1 Input
1 Output
-
217625f94132e6389459b70a7e26f183402f6cadfbc3159c1a98e22a758033d5:0
- value
- 178289640
- script pubkey
- OP_0 OP_PUSHBYTES_20 6aad62cbc9235412058a045329f1c0cd0efa76ab
- address
- bc1qd2kk9j7fyd2pypv2q3fjnuwqe5805a4t2qjkjq